Net interest income Highlights Includes interest-bearing cash and due from banks and deposits in banks. Linked quarter: NII up $36 million, or 4% Reflects loan growth, day count benefit and an 8 bp increase in NIM NIM of 3.05% up from 2.97% in second quarter 2017 Reflects improved interest-earning asset yields and the benefit of higher short-term rates, partially offset by higher funding costs Results include a 2 bp benefit tied to higher-than-expected commercial loan interest recoveries Prior-year quarter: NII up $117 million, or 12%, with NIM up 21 bps Reflects 5.4% growth in loans and loans held for sale Growth in NIM reflects improved commercial and retail loan yields, driven by balance sheet optimization initiatives and higher rates, partially offset by higher funding costs Net interest income $s in millions, except earning assets Average interest-earning assets Average interest-earning assets Net interest income Net interest margin

Noninterest income Highlights $s in millions Service charges and fees Card fees Capital markets fees Trust & inv services fees LC and loan fees FX and int rate products Mortgage banking fees Securities gains, net Other Linked quarter: Noninterest income increased $11 million 2Q17 results include an $11 million impact from finance lease impairments recorded in other income Stable compared to 2Q17 Underlying noninterest income(1) Service charges and fees increased 2%, reflecting seasonality Capital markets fees increased 4% to record levels, driven by an increase in bond underwriting and advisory fees, reflecting active markets and our broader capabilities Trust and investment services fees were relatively stable, as business continues to migrate towards more managed money mix Foreign exchange and interest rate products fees decreased 8%, largely reflecting a reduction in demand for variable rate loan hedges given the timing of interest rate moves and seasonality Mortgage banking fees down 10%, with lower loan sale gains partially offset by higher production fees Other income increased $16 million from lower second quarter levels that included the $11 million impact of finance lease impairments and a $3 million other-than-temporary-impairment charge tied to a model update Prior-year quarter: Noninterest income down 12%; up 4% on an Adjusted basis(1) Card fees increased 12%, reflecting lower processing fees and higher purchase volume Capital markets fees increased 47%, reflecting strength in loan syndications, bond and equity fees and advisory fees given stronger market volumes and our expanded capabilities Trust and investment services fees were relatively stable, reflecting a shift in sales mix Foreign exchange and interest rate products fees decreased 14% on lower variable rate loan demand Mortgage banking fees decreased $6 million, driven by a decrease in loan sale gains and spreads, partially offset by an increase in servicing fees

Average funding and cost of funds Highlights $s in billions Average interest-bearing liabilities and DDA Total long-term borrowings Fed funds, repo, ST borrowed funds Term deposits Checking with interest DDA Money market & savings Linked quarter: Total average deposits up $2.2 billion, or 2% Largely reflects strong growth in term deposits, money market accounts, demand deposits and checking with interest Total deposit costs of 0.43% increased 6 bps, reflecting the impact of higher interest rates Total cost of funds increased 7 bps, which includes the impact of 2Q17 term debt issuance Prior-year quarter: Average total deposits up $6.3 billion, or 6%, on strength across all categories Total deposit costs increased 16 bps as the impact of higher short-term rates was partially offset by growth in lower-cost categories and continued pricing discipline Total cost of funds increased 19 bps and included the impact of the shift toward a more balanced mix of long-term and short-term funding along with the impact of higher interest rates

Consumer Commercial CFG Summary of progress on strategic initiatives Initiative 3Q17 Status Commentary Grow and deepen relationships with primary households Continue to build out Mass Affluent and Affluent value propositions. Added ~7,000 primary HHs with a loan or investment. Embarked on several customer journey transformations to enhance customer experience, improve primacy of customer relationships and reduce costs. Enhance mortgage platform Higher secondary volume QoQ more than offset by a reduction in portfolio volume as we further reposition business. Shifted focus towards increasing efficiency of the existing LOs and have trimmed number of portfolio-heavy LOs. Building out a direct-to-consumer channel to grow conforming originations and improve returns. Optimize Auto Continued optimization of both volumes and returns in the business through targeted pricing improvements and management of dealer network, focusing on most profitable dealer relationships. Grow Education/Unsecured Credit Continued strong momentum in education and unsecured with total loan balances up 39% and 203% YoY, respectively. Corporate partner-linked installment credit balances doubled YoY; seeing good progress from new corporate partnerships, such as Vivint, with solid pipeline of other potential partnerships. Enhance Business Banking Deposit balances up 3% YoY though loan demand remains muted. Improving share-of-wallet through product and process enhancements. Launched pilot of new digital lending capability to existing customers. Expand Wealth Managed money sales up 30% YoY, though transactional sales were down in line with industry trends given DOL transition impact. Fee-based sale mix improved to 41% from 30% in 3Q16; mix shift positive long term, though near term headwind. Rolled out digital investment advice technology (SpeciFi) to existing customers. Continue development of Capital and Global Markets activities Fee income up 43% YoY reflecting strong growth in syndications fees and bond & equity underwriting; bolstered M&A capabilities via WRP acquisition (closed May 2017). Strong M&A pipeline. Build out Treasury Solutions Total fees up 7% YoY, driven by 31% increase in commercial card fees given strong purchase volume growth, and 14% increase in trade fees. Focused on optimizing back book, enhancing sales discipline and banker alignment, and investing in new product initiatives/technology re-platform. Strong deposit growth of 10% YoY. Expand Mid-Corporate & Middle Market(1) Loan and deposit balances up 4% and 9%, respectively, driven by customer growth and initiatives to deepen relationships. Seeing modest balance sheet growth in established markets, and making investments to grow in expansion markets, including Southeast and Metro NYC. Build out Industry Verticals & Franchise Finance(1) Industry vertical loan growth of 7% YoY and fee income up $12 million YoY. Continued expansion in well-established brands of quick service and fast casual franchises, with 12% loan growth YoY. Prudently grow CRE Continue to deepen client penetration with top developers in core geographies, while moderating growth in multi-family and retail sectors. CRE loans grew 13% YoY to $10.7 billion. Reposition Asset Finance Continue to realign product offering and strategy towards core Middle Market and Mid-Corp customers to drive greater bank alignment; reducing focus on large ticket, such as aircraft, and focusing on mid-ticket, such as construction and transportation. Balance Sheet Optimization NIM increased 21 bps YoY and 8 bps QoQ with approximately 10 bps of the increase due to continued execution of balance sheet strategies targeting improved mix and pricing. Continue to optimize auto and asset finance portfolios for higher returns. TOP III TOP III Program on track to meet expected run-rate pre-tax benefit of ~$110 million by end of 2017. TOP IV TOP IV Program, which includes both efficiency and revenue initiatives, is underway and on track to meet end of 2018 run-rate pre-tax benefit of $95-$110 million.
